Reusable Packaging Association launches 2023 State of the Reusable Packaging Industry survey

Anonymous insights from reusable packaging users, manufacturers, poolers, suppliers, and service providers will inform RPA’s 2nd State of the Reusable Packaging Industry Report


The Reusable Packaging Association (RPA) has launched its 2023 State of the Reusable Packaging Industry Survey, seeking insights into the trends shaping the reusable transport packaging industry. The RPA is seeking responses from a broad industry audience, including:

  • Users of reusable packaging (Retailers, wholesalers, manufacturers, processors, growers, distribution and logistics providers, and government agencies)
  • Manufacturers and poolers of reusable packaging (pallets, containers, crates, totes, IBCs, drums, tanks, dunnage, racks, carts, dollies, and cargo protection)
  • Suppliers / service providers to reusable packaging systems (washing & sanitizing equipment and services, sort and return services, asset repair, technology equipment and services, raw materials, engineering & design, and transportation & logistics)

The survey takes only 5 minutes to complete and is entirely anonymous. The insights gleaned from this important research will be used to inform the second State of the Reusable Packaging Industry Report to be published later this year.
